Kaltura Media Retention Policy

Kaltura media platform is not intended to be used for long-term data storage or backup of media that is not in use. Content owners are expected to retain original media files as their own backup on your personal device. Any inactive media content in Kaltura will be automatically moved to your Kaltura Recycle Bin. The criteria to be moved are:  

  • Content that is created older than 2 years from the current time, AND  
  • Content that has not been played for 2 years (0 play) 

During the 30-day window, you can restore the media from the “Recycle Bin” to your My Media library. After 30 days, the content will be permanently deleted from the Kaltura platform.

Frequently Asked Questions 

1. How will I be notified that my media is moved to the recycle bin? 

You will receive an email notification that your inactive media is moved to your Recycle Bin on My Media page. 

2. How do I restore a video from the Recycle Bin? 

  1. Log in to SLATE 
  1. Click My Media tab from SLATE home screen 
  1. Click My recycle bin button to view your media 
  1. Click ACTIONS > Restore button
